A Hot Product
Dynamotive has been producing bio-oil and char for several years in Canada, says Desmond Radlein, the company's chief scientist. The company uses waste wood from the timber industry as a feedstock. Radlein views the bio-oil as the primary product and the char as a secondary product. "If you pyrolyze wood under fast pyrolysis conditions you might get 70 percent of a liquid as a product with some gas and some char as a byproduct," he says. "Fast pyrolysis is a fairly well established technology. Several people are practicing it and trying to commercialize it. The basic idea is to make a liquid fuel. It isn't a high-grade fuel. You can't burn it in your car but you can burn it in boilers and gas turbines."
Dynamotive began its work on fast pyrolysis at about the same time terra preta soils became a hot research topic. "It turns out that the conditions under which the char is made under pyrolysis seem also to be the optimal conditions to making a good char for soil amendment purposes," Radlein says. "Char is a secondary product, but from that perspective, one is always looking to see what one can do with it."
There are several uses for pyrolysis char, Radlein says. It can be converted into activated carbon. Char can be compressed into charcoal briquettes or used to make gunpowder. "The activated carbon market is very big," Radlein says. "It is used for water treatment among other things. But (agricultural uses) would be a potentially very big market."

June 25 | News | Freestone Resources
Freestone Resources, Inc. (OTCQB: FSNR) and Dynamis Energy, LLC today announced a joint venture intended to vertically integrate the Petrozene product line. Petrozene, used as an additive, provides a cost-effective solution for dealing with tanker sludge, paraffin problems, storage tank maintenance, and more.
Under the agreement, Freestone and Dynamis will share resources with the goal of normalizing supply of the chemicals necessary for the production and supply of Petrozene.
Freestone and Dynamis have been working diligently for over a year to develop the strategy to complete this transaction, which will provide world-scale supply of the Petrozene product line. This transaction has resulted in the formation of Freestone Dynamis Energy Products, LLC (FDEP).
“This has been a complex transaction that involved the coordination of multiple parties, but I firmly believe that our persistence and dedication to this project will pave the way for the expansion of Freestone and the development of our relationship with Dynamis,” said Clayton Carter, CEO at Freestone Resources.
The transaction includes the purchase of the Texas-based company, C.C. Crawford Retreading Company, Inc. (CTR). CTR is located in Ennis, Texas and has been in the tire disposal and repair business since 1987. As a wholly owned subsidiary of Freestone, CTR will continue its ongoing operations and will be the catalyst for consistent feedstock for Petrozene. FDEP will be installing and operating a proprietary technology for Petrozene at the site. The necessary infrastructure for immediate operations of the technology is already in place at the CTR facility.
The specific technology that FDEP will operate at the CTR site has been in commercial operation for several years, and its products have been utilized successfully to make Petrozene. Freestone and Dynamis have conducted substantial due diligence on the technology and are confident that implementation of the technology will provide Freestone the necessary control over the production of Petrozene. This consistent supply will provide opportunities to accept long-term contracts for large volumes of Petrozene sales. The technology will also produce other byproducts of value that can result in additional revenue streams.
Kevin McNulty, CEO of Dynamis Energy said, “We are very pleased to partner with Freestone Resources and excited about the opportunity to combine our technology expertise with Freestone and it’s revolutionary Petrozene product. This is the first of many projects we expect to come from this Joint Venture.”
